Khaleda Zia’s condition still critical

Physicians said they will start working on two more blocks in her heart after 72 hours of observation

Update : 13 Jun 2022, 09:16 PM

BNP Chairperson Khaleda Zia’s condition has still not stabilized and her condition is still critical, her physicians said on Monday. 

“We will be working on two more heart blockages after 72 hours of observations,” said Professor Dr AZM Zahid Hossain, Khaleda’s personal physician. 

He made the announcement after a meeting of the medical board formed for the treatment of the former prime minister at Evercare Hospital. 

Khaleda is still under the observation of doctors in the Coronary Care Unit (CCU) at Evercare Hospital in Dhaka. 

Earlier on Sunday, three blockages were found in the arteries of the BNP chairperson through a coronary angiogram test conducted on Saturday, Zahid Hossain said. 

Zahid, also a BNP vice chairman, said Khaleda suffered a heart attack due to around a 95% blockage in her left artery. “A stent has been placed there by removing the blockage.”

He added doctors will take proper measures in this regard after observing her condition as she has chronic kidney and liver problems.

Khaleda, was admitted to Evercare Hospital in the early hours of Saturday as she suddenly fell ill. A ring (stent) was placed in the main artery of her heart on Saturday afternoon.

Khaleda, a 76-year-old former prime minister, has long been suffering from various ailments, including liver cirrhosis, arthritis, diabetes, kidney, lung and eye problems.
